Re: Black Rock Wheat
Every Black Rock kit comes with the same basic Ale yeast - which is, unless I'm very much mistaken, the same basic Ale yeast that comes with every Goldrush, Tooheys and Brewiser kit can, regardless of the style on the label.
If you want a wheat yeast, aside from the obvious 3068 Weihenstephan ...
